Output b84ae94cef6a6019b3f947e98992f94807d895a8bfdfc0f4a43caf62b4fca8ba:3

value
27242612
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fc64c3ffddfe4dd63df693956c86b343403143aa OP_EQUAL
address
MWuhE69wAL2ivfGGNFKXTjHwDGPQa3bcMR
transaction
b84ae94cef6a6019b3f947e98992f94807d895a8bfdfc0f4a43caf62b4fca8ba
spent
true